Nonce di Blockchain: Komponen Kunci yang Menjamin Integritas Jaringan

Dalam ekosistem cryptocurrency, nonce memainkan peran yang jauh lebih dari sekadar detail teknis. Angka acak satu kali pakai ini telah menjadi elemen penting untuk melindungi seluruh arsitektur blockchain. Tanpanya, rantai blok akan kehilangan sebagian besar kemampuan pertahanannya terhadap manipulasi yang berniat jahat.

Apa yang Mendefinisikan Nonce dan Mengapa Itu Sangat Penting?

Kata “nonce” berasal dari singkatan “number used once” (angka yang digunakan sekali), dan tepat itulah fungsi utamanya: sebuah nilai acak yang dihasilkan secara unik untuk setiap operasi kriptografi. Dalam konteks transaksi blockchain, nonce disisipkan ke dalam data transaksi untuk menghasilkan pengenal hash unik melalui fungsi kriptografi seperti SHA-256.

Proses ini menghasilkan nilai otentikasi yang diperlukan untuk memvalidasi keabsahan setiap blok. Hash yang dihasilkan dibandingkan dengan target yang telah ditetapkan berdasarkan tingkat kesulitan yang ditentukan jaringan. Ketika hash memenuhi kriteria ini, blok tersebut ditambahkan ke rantai dan menjadi bagian tak berubah dari catatan sejarah.

Peran Krusial Nonce dalam Keamanan Blockchain

Alasan utama mengapa nonce sangat penting adalah kemampuannya untuk mencegah penipuan. Tanpa komponen acak ini, penambang bisa saja menggunakan kembali data transaksi sebelumnya dan menerima hadiah berulang untuk pekerjaan yang sama. Nonce memastikan bahwa setiap blok bersifat eksklusif dan bahwa kompensasi penambangan didistribusikan secara benar.

Mekanisme keamanan ini menjaga integritas seluruh jaringan. Ia melindungi pengguna dengan memastikan tidak ada penambang yang dapat menduplikasi blok valid untuk mendapatkan keuntungan tidak adil. Keacakan terkendali yang diperkenalkan nonce menjaga rantai blok tetap tahan terhadap upaya manipulasi, sehingga mempertahankan kepercayaan yang menjadi dasar seluruh sistem.

Bagaimana Nonce Berperan dalam Mekanisme Penambangan

Proses operasionalnya cukup sederhana namun efektif. Ketika seorang penambang memulai pembuatan blok, ia memilih sekumpulan transaksi tertunda dan melampirkan nilai nonce yang dihasilkan secara acak. Kemudian, seluruh kumpulan ini diproses melalui fungsi kriptografi yang menghasilkan kode hash.

Jika hash yang dihasilkan memenuhi standar kesulitan yang ditetapkan, blok tersebut divalidasi dan ditambahkan ke catatan blockchain. Penambang kemudian menerima hadiah yang sesuai. Jika hash tidak memenuhi kriteria, penambang mengubah nonce dan mencoba lagi. Pengulangan ini berlanjut sampai mendapatkan hash yang valid, yang menjelaskan mengapa penambangan membutuhkan daya komputasi yang signifikan.

Nonce, Bukti Kerja, dan Kesulitan: Sebuah Triad Esensial

Nonce tidak beroperasi secara terpisah; ia merupakan bagian integral dari mekanisme bukti kerja, yaitu algoritma konsensus yang digunakan oleh banyak jaringan blockchain utama. Bukti kerja mengharuskan penambang membuktikan investasi energi komputasi mereka dengan menyelesaikan masalah matematika—tepat di sinilah peran utama nonce.

Kesulitan proses ini disesuaikan secara otomatis dalam interval tertentu, memastikan bahwa blok dihasilkan dengan kecepatan yang konsisten. Semakin banyak penambang yang bergabung ke jaringan, semakin tinggi tingkat kesulitannya, membutuhkan lebih banyak percobaan nonce untuk menemukan hash yang valid. Dengan cara ini, nonce, kesulitan, dan bukti kerja saling terkait untuk menjaga kestabilan dan keamanan blockchain.

Lebih dari Sekadar Penambangan: Peran Nonce dalam Konteks Blockchain Lainnya

Meskipun nonce lebih dikenal karena perannya dalam penambangan berdasarkan bukti kerja, kegunaannya meluas ke bidang lain dalam jaringan blockchain. Dalam transaksi Ethereum dan banyak platform lainnya, nonce menghitung jumlah transaksi yang dikirim dari alamat tertentu, mencegah pengulangan dan mengurutkan operasi secara sekuensial.

Penggunaan nonce yang berbeda ini dalam lapisan aplikasi menunjukkan fleksibilitasnya sebagai alat keamanan. Setiap konteks memanfaatkan kemampuannya untuk menjamin keunikan guna menyelesaikan masalah validasi dan pencegahan duplikasi, memperkuat arsitektur perlindungan umum yang menjadi ciri sistem blockchain modern.

Kesimpulan: Pentingnya Nonce yang Tak Tergoyahkan

Tidak dapat diremehkan pengaruh nonce dalam struktur fundamental cryptocurrency. Komponen acak ini adalah yang mencegah penambangan menjadi proses penipuan di mana blok yang sama digunakan berulang kali tanpa henti. Nonce menjaga jaringan tetap aman, penambang jujur, dan pengguna terlindungi.

Tanpanya, rantai blok akan rentan terhadap manipulasi massal dan kehilangan seluruh kegunaannya sebagai catatan tak berubah yang dipercaya. Meskipun tampak sederhana, nonce merupakan salah satu pilar utama yang menopang keamanan seluruh infrastruktur blockchain modern.

Lihat Asli
Halaman ini mungkin berisi konten pihak ketiga, yang disediakan untuk tujuan informasi saja (bukan pernyataan/jaminan) dan tidak boleh dianggap sebagai dukungan terhadap pandangannya oleh Gate, atau sebagai nasihat keuangan atau profesional. Lihat Penafian untuk detailnya.
  • Hadiah
  • Komentar
  • Posting ulang
  • Bagikan
Komentar
Tambahkan komentar
Tambahkan komentar
Tidak ada komentar
  • Sematkan